E.B. seeks artists for fine art, craft show/sale
The East Brunswick Arts Commission and the Visual Arts Celebration Committee will sponsor an outdoor, juried fine art and craft show and sale on June 14. Entries will be judged in oils/acrylics, watercolors, photography, fine hand crafts, graphics/drawings/pastels, photography and sculpture. Cash prizes will be awarded. Student art is welcome. MCC presents China photography exhibit
MCC presents China photography exhibit "A View Through the Moon Gate," original photography of China by Kirstin Calamoneri, will be presented by Middlesex County College (MCC), Edison, through Feb. 3 in the college’s Presidential Arts Gallery, Chambers Hall.
